About Kahuku Elementary School

Kahuku Elementary School is a public elementary school in Kahuku, HI, part of Hawaii Department of Education. Kahuku Elementary School serves approximately 349 students, and covers grades Pre-K-6th, and has a 15.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Kahuku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.8 out of 10 and ranks #265 of 292 schools in HI.

Structured state assessment records for Kahuku Elementary School show 44%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 53%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

Kahuku Elementary School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.

41% of students at Kahuku Elementary School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
